Temple woman accused of shooting at women in Killeen faces trial
A Temple woman who is accused of shooting at two women in Killeen during a child custody-related incident almost four years ago, is set to face a jury this week. Kyia Brownlee, who also is known as Kyia Withers, 30, was indicted by a Bell County grand jury on Dec. 16, 2020, on two charges: aggravated assault with a deadly weapon, which is a second-degree felony, and deadly conduct by discharge of firearm, a third-degree felony.

Ice cream manufacturing facility coming to Nolanville
Aronka’s Five Star Creations is coming to Nolanville as an ice cream manufacturing facility. The Nolanville City Council approved the lease request by Arokna Robertson to bring her custom ice cream business to Nolanville at Thursday’s meeting.

Thunderstorms spark accidents throughout Killeen and surrounding areas
Killeen Police and Fire Departments were kept busy Monday as a midday thunderstorm rolled through, flooding streets; several accidents were reported. From about noon through 3 p.m., short periods of heavy showers overloaded drainage systems throughout the city.

Bell County man indicted in baby kidnapping
Belton, Tx (FOX 44) – A Bell County Grand Jury has returned a kidnapping indictment against a man accused of abducting a baby from a Belton apartment in April. Eighteen-year-old Joseph Juan Diego Martinez has remained in the Bell County Jail since his arrest in April shortly after the incident.

Today is Guam Liberation Day
While today marks the 80th anniversary of Guam Liberation Day, there was no big celebration in the Killeen-Copperas Cove area this year. Typically, the Chamorro Association of Central Texas organizes a local Guam Liberation Day celebration at Ogletree Gap Park in Copperas Cove — an annual event that attracts 1,000 to 2,000 people.
